- The distance between Zugspitze, Germany and San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island, Juan Fernández Islands is approximately 12,668 km or 7,872 mi.
- To reach Zugspitze in this distance one would set out from San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island bearing 47.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Zugspitze bearing 65.7° or ENE .
- Zugspitze has a tundra climate (ET) whereas San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The mean temperature is 20.1 °C (36.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.2 °C (13°F) more in Zugspitze.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 962.5 mm (37.9 in) more which is equivalent to 962.5 l/m² (23.62 US gal/ft²) or 9,625,000 l/ha (1,028,976 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.1° lower in Zugspitze than in San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island.
